These capacities are gross ratings. For net capacity,
deduct air blower motor, MBh = 3.415 x kW. Refer to the
appropriate Blower Performance Table for the kW of the
supply air blower motor.
These ratings include the condens
er fan motors (total 1
kW) and the compressor motors but not the supply air
blower motor.
